WebMay 26, 2010 · In 2008, a record 41% of births in the U.S. were to unmarried women. This includes a majority of births to women younger than age 25 (59% to unmarried mothers). In total, 1.7 million babies were born to unmarried mothers in 2008. By comparison, 2.5 million babies were born to married mothers (59% of all births). how high helicopters flyWebMar 23, 2024 · Get in touch with us now. , Mar 23, 2024.
